Mount Pleasant SC Countertop Replacement: A Step-by-Step Look
The surface installation process in Charleston, SC, typically includes several distinct phases. First, accurate assessments of your cabinets are made. Next, the selected stone, whether it’s marble, is carefully fabricated to the correct dimensions. Then, the current surface is disconnected with care, verifying minimal damage to the nearby area. Following this, the new countertop is gently positioned onto the cabinets and attached with strong adhesive. Finally, the joints are sealed and buffed to a smooth appearance, resulting in a remarkable and robust upgrade to your space.
Stylish Countertops in Charleston: Trends & Inspiration
Charleston homes are renowned for their charm , and the kitchen is no exception. Currently, designers are seeing a surge in popularity for countertops that blend classic appeal with a contemporary edge. Quartz remains a favorite due to its durability and diverse array of colors and patterns, particularly those mimicking natural marble. However, genuine marble, like Calacatta and Carrara, continues to be appreciated for its premium aesthetic, while butcher block provides a cozy and charming feel. And lastly, concrete countertops are gaining traction for those seeking an industrial look, often paired with bold fixtures and sleek cabinetry.
Selecting the Right Countertop Installer in Charleston
Choosing a reputable countertop company in Charleston can feel tricky, but it's vital for a beautiful kitchen or bathroom upgrade. Start your quest by getting several bids from local businesses. Check online testimonials on sites like HomeAdvisor and the Better Business Association . Don't be afraid to request client lists and see previous installations to guarantee their quality . A good contractor will be insured and present a detailed proposal outlining the specifics of the job and the timeline . Remember, cost isn't everything; evaluate their experience and approach as also.
